Forecast: Wages and Salaries of Renting and Leasing of Cars and Light Motor Vehicles in Italy

In 2023, the wages and salaries for the renting and leasing of cars and light motor vehicles in Italy stood at a significant benchmark. Forecasted data shows a steady growth trend from 2024 to 2028, with an increase from €501.5 million in 2024 to €618.8 million in 2028, showcasing a consistent upward trajectory.

The year-on-year growth rates reflect a healthy industry outlook with percentages indicating steady increments throughout the forecast period. The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) over these five years reflects the average annual growth, indicating a strong sector performance overall.

Future trends to watch for include changes in consumer preferences towards electric and hybrid vehicles, shifts in taxation policies, and the impact of economic factors such as GDP growth and inflation. These factors will play a crucial role in shaping the industry’s wage and salary forecasts.
